LifeMD Faces Lawsuit Over Financial Transparency Issues

LifeMD Under Legal Scrutiny for Alleged Misleading Statements
A recent class action lawsuit has been filed against LifeMD (NASDAQ: LFMD), focusing on claims that the telehealth company and its executives provided investors with an inaccurate representation of their financial stability and growth potential. This lawsuit comes in the wake of a significant decline in LifeMD's stock price after disappointing earnings reports.
Details of the Lawsuit
The lawsuit, referred to as Johnston v. LifeMD, Inc., highlights the period from May 7 to August 5. It is asserted that LifeMD made false and misleading claims, particularly on May 6 when the company reported first-quarter results and boosted its annual revenue and adjusted EBITDA projections. The lawsuit alleges that LifeMD's optimistic outlook regarding its virtual obesity care initiatives and the performance of its RexMD brand failed to disclose critical challenges the company was facing.
Key Allegations
Among the significant concerns raised in the lawsuit are increasing customer acquisition costs within the RexMD segment and a higher refund rate than expected in the weight management sector. These operational issues were not disclosed to investors, leading to a distorted view of the company's performance.
Impact on Investors
The deceit, as alleged in the lawsuit, became apparent when LifeMD announced its second-quarter financial results on August 5, which missed both revenue and earnings expectations. The company subsequently revised its full-year guidance downward, stating that it faced "temporary elevated customer acquisition costs" within RexMD and issues with patient refunds in their weight management services. This series of revelations resulted in a substantial drop of over 44% in LifeMD's stock price the following day.

Hagens Berman's Role
Hagens Berman, a legal firm focused on plaintiffs' rights, is investigating the complaints against LifeMD. Reed Kathrein, a partner at the firm, emphasized the importance of determining whether LifeMD was aware of critical operational challenges and failed to inform shareholders accordingly.
